The Bovine Mastitis Market was valued at USD 1.41 billion in 2023, expected to reach USD 1.48 billion in 2024, and is projected to grow at a CAGR of 5.72%, to USD 2.08 billion by 2030.
Bovine Mastitis refers to the inflammation of the mammary gland in dairy cattle, primarily caused by bacterial infection. This condition significantly impacts dairy production, reducing milk yield and quality, and increasing veterinary costs, thus necessitating effective management strategies. Addressing bovine mastitis involves applications in pharmaceuticals, diagnostics, and automated milking systems designed to prevent, detect, and treat infections. The end-use scope primarily encompasses dairy farms, veterinary clinics, and research institutes. Key growth influencers include the increasing demand for dairy products, advancements in veterinary healthcare, and the shift towards sustainable and organic farming practices. Innovations in diagnostic technologies, such as biosensors and molecular assays, provide lucrative opportunities. These innovations enable early and accurate detection, promoting improved herd health management and higher milk production efficiency. Ongoing development in automated milking machinery and data analytics tools also offers significant potential to revolutionize herd management practices by continuously monitoring animal health.

However, market growth is challenged by factors like antibiotic resistance, regulatory concerns over treatment residues in milk, and the high cost of advanced diagnostic solutions. Additionally, inconsistent disease management practices across different regions hinder the uniform application of solutions. Investment in new antibiotics and alternative therapies such as probiotics and vaccines is crucial, notwithstanding the necessity for stringent regulatory adherence. Research in genetic markers for mastitis resistance and enhancing the efficacy of existing treatments remains a key area for innovation. Collaborating with academic institutions and leveraging advanced technologies like AI for predictive analytics in herd health management can further drive growth.
